CLOZE TEST - 02

Malnutrition remains a ..... (1) ..... challenge in India, affecting millions of individuals across diverse socio-economic strata. The multifaceted nature of this issue demands a holistic and comprehensive approach to address the root causes and implement effective solutions. From stunted growth in children to anaemia among women, the ..... (2) ..... of malnutrition are farreaching, impacting the overall health and development of the nation. One key aspect of ..... (3) ..... malnutrition involves enhancing awareness about proper nutrition and its crucial role in overall well-being. Education campaigns must target not only urban areas but also remote villages where access to information is limited. ..... (4) ..... communities with knowledge about balanced diets, breastfeeding practices, and the importance of micronutrients can pave the way for sustainable change. The promotion of exclusive breastfeeding in the first six months of an infant’s life is a fundamental strategy to combat malnutrition. Initiatives must focus on dispelling myths surrounding breastfeeding, emphasizing its unmatched nutritional benefits and its role in preventing infections. Establishing lactation support groups and integrating these practices into maternal healthcare programs can encourage and enable mothers to provide the best possible start for their children. Nutritional supplementation programs play a crucial role, especially in regions where dietary diversity is a challenge. Government initiatives should ensure the distribution of fortified food products and essential micronutrients to ..... (5) ..... populations. This includes fortifying staple foods like rice, wheat, and salt with essential vitamins and minerals, addressing deficiencies and promoting healthier diets. Agricultural reforms can significantly contribute to the fight against malnutrition. Encouraging ..... (6) ..... crop cultivation and supporting small-scale farmers in adopting sustainable practices can improve the availability of nutrient-rich foods. Government incentives and subsidies for the cultivation of fruits, vegetables, and pulses can not only enhance nutritional diversity but also create a more resilient and ..... (7) ..... food supply chain. Public health interventions should prioritize regular health check-ups, especially for pregnant women and children. Early detection of malnutrition and its related health issues allows for timely and targeted interventions. Mobile health clinics and community health workers can play a ..... (8) ..... role in reaching remote areas, ensuring that healthcare services are accessible to all. School-based nutrition programs are instrumental in ..... (9) ..... healthy habits from an early age. Integrating nutritious meals into school curricula not only addresses the nutritional needs of children but also fosters a culture of healthy eating. Collaborations with local communities and NGOs can enhance the effectiveness of such programs, ensuring that they are tailored to the specific needs of each region. Empowering women is central to any successful strategy against malnutrition. Women often play a pivotal role in food choices and meal preparation within households. By providing education, vocational training, and economic opportunities to women, we can elevate their influence and ..... (10) ..... to better nutritional outcomes for entire families.

Directions (Qs. 1 - 10): In the following passage, there are blanks each of which has been numbered from 1 to 10. Against each number, five words are suggested and only one word fits the blank appropriately. Find out the appropriate word in all the cases.

1.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(1) .....

A) persistent  B) negligible  C) fleeting  D) temporary  E) minimal

2.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(2) .....

A) reasons   B) consequences   C) benefits   D) excuses   E) choices

3.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(3) .....

A) releasing   B) letting  C) combating   D) helping   E) aiding

4.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(4) .....

A) Reducing   B) Abolishing   C) Deleting   D) Empowering   E) Neglecting

5.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(5) .....

A) lazy   B) powerful   C) indomitable   D) strong   E) vulnerable

6.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(6) .....

A) diverse   B) common   C) difficult   D) strange   E) cruel

7.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(7) .....

A) removable  B) sustainable   C) deductible   D) reducible   E) possible

8.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(8) .....

A) general   B) trivial   C) vital   D) casual   E) regular

9.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(9) .....

A) neglecting  B) hindering   C) stopping   D) nurturing   E) eradicating

10. Select the most appropriate option for ..... (10) .....

A) clear   B) trouble    C) expel    D) deduct    E) contribute

Key

1-A;   2-B;   3-C;   4-D;   5-E;   6-A;   7-B;   8-C;   9-D;    10-E.
